Echo of Love

Through coaxing and pleading I was made to yield,

But you too, by forswearing, lost your faith and creed.

 

Having got my heart gratis,lo,he syes; No use''

Instead of thanking me, behold,blame on me he heaps.

 

The desire-deserted heart presents a fearsome sight,

When the guest departs, the house is but bereaved.

 

Ask me not what all I saw in the idol- house,

In faith,of my zealous faith I was there relieved.

 

Unveiling my secret heart hurt my self-esteem,

But I did make my point, did explain my need.

 

Although he wasn,t with my courier pleased.

Thank God  he knew my name, did pay some heed.

 

Sense and poise, strenth and vigour have left me one and all.,

My goods have gone before me ,I,m about to leave.
